Answer: The second option represents a slope of 1/4

Step-by-step explanation:

To find slope, select two points along the line and plug them into this equation: (y2-y1)/(x2-x1)

We'll take the two points in the second graph and plug them into the equation above: (4-3)/(4-0)= 1/4

Therefore, the second option represents a slope of 1/4. Hope this helps:)

6 minus the difference of x and 3, in a algebraic expression.
user100 [1]

Answer:

9-x

Step-by-step explanation:

The difference between x and 3 is x-3.

Now 6 minus x-3:

6-(x-3)=

= 6-x+3

= 9-x
